Iperius Backup

Iperius Backup is a lightweight yet powerful backup solution designed to protect your entire digital environment. You can manage backups for Windows PCs, servers, and databases from a single interface, ensuring your critical business data remains safe from hardware failure or ransomware. It supports a wide range of destinations, allowing you to send your files to local drives, network paths, or popular cloud services like Google Drive and Amazon S3.

The software is particularly effective for small to medium businesses that need to protect virtual environments like VMware ESXi and Hyper-V. You can perform hot backups without interrupting your workflow, creating drive images for complete system recovery. With its perpetual licensing model, you avoid recurring monthly fees while maintaining full control over your backup strategy and data sovereignty.

Macrium Reflect

Macrium Reflect provides you with a reliable way to protect your data through advanced disk imaging and cloning technology. You can create accurate images of your hard disk partitions, allowing you to recover your entire system, individual folders, or specific files in the event of hardware failure or data corruption. It simplifies the process of upgrading your storage by enabling direct disk-to-disk cloning for seamless transitions to new drives.

The software serves everyone from home users protecting personal photos to large enterprises managing fleet-wide backups. You can automate your protection using flexible templates and retention policies that manage your storage space efficiently. Whether you need to restore a crashed Windows system to different hardware or simply mount a backup as a virtual drive to grab a single file, the platform provides the tools to keep your digital life secure.

Iperius Backup Features

  • Drive Image Backup Create complete images of your entire system disk so you can perform a bare-metal recovery in minutes.
  • Virtual Machine Protection Back up VMware ESXi and Hyper-V virtual machines while they are running without any downtime for your users.
  • Database Backups Protect your SQL Server, Oracle, MySQL, and PostgreSQL databases with automated scheduling and advanced compression options.
  • Cloud Integration Send your backups directly to Google Drive, Dropbox, OneDrive, Azure, or any S3-compatible storage for offsite redundancy.
  • Ransomware Protection Secure your data against cyberattacks with built-in protection that detects and blocks unauthorized file encryption attempts.
  • Centralized Management Monitor all your backup jobs across multiple computers from a single web console to ensure everything runs smoothly.

Macrium Reflect Features

  • Rapid Delta Restore. Recover your systems in a fraction of the time by only restoring the data blocks that have changed since the last backup.
  • Direct Disk Cloning. Copy your entire operating system and data directly to a new drive to make hardware upgrades fast and painless.
  • viBoot Technology. Create and manage Microsoft Hyper-V virtual machines instantly from your backup images for immediate disaster recovery testing.
  • Ransomware Protection. Prevent unauthorized modification of your backup files with Macrium Image Guardian, ensuring your recovery points stay safe from malware.
  • Incremental Backups. Save storage space and time by only backing up the specific changes made to your files since your previous save.
  • Bare Metal Recovery. Restore your entire system to completely different hardware or a brand new disk even if the operating system won't boot.
